Misted Window Replacement: A Complete Guide
Misted windows are a typical issue dealt with by homeowners, often resulting in a decreased visual appeal and compromised energy performance. This problem takes place when the insulating seal of double or triple-glazed windows fails, allowing moisture to enter the area between the panes. As a result, condensation kinds and produces an unsightly misty appearance that can obscure the view and lower natural light.

Comprehending Misted Windows
Misted windows are generally a sign of damage to the window's seal. When learn more working, moisture seeps in and can not leave, causing condensation between the panes of glass. This prevails in older windows however can happen in newer models if they are improperly produced or improperly installed.
Causes of Misted Windows
The following table lays out some common reasons for misted windows:
| Cause | Description |
|---|---|
| Seal Failure | The most typical cause, where the protective seal around the glass panes breaks down. |
| Temperature level Fluctuations | Rapid temperature changes can cause growth and contraction, stressing the window seal. |
| Incorrect Installation | If windows are not set up correctly, it can result in premature failure of seals. |
| Age | Older windows are more vulnerable to seal failure due to use and tear. |
| Ecological Stress | Direct exposure to extreme climate condition can damage seals with time. |
The Replacement Process
When dealing with misted windows, it's important to comprehend what the replacement process involves. Here's a detailed breakdown:
Step 1: Assessment
Assess the level of the damage. If the window is old and worn, it might be more affordable to replace the whole system instead of simply the glass.
Action 2: Choosing the Right Replacement
Select between replacing the whole window unit or going with a window glass replacement. The table listed below shows the pros and cons of each choice:
| Option |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Full Window Replacement | Improved energy effectiveness, enhanced visual appeals, and brand-new guarantee. | Greater upfront cost, more lengthy setup. |
| Glass Replacement | More economical, quicker procedure, less disruption. | Might not address underlying frame concerns, restricted life-span of new glass. |
Step 3: Professional Consultation
Speak with a professional glazier or window replacement expert to guarantee a correct assessment and estimate for the task.
Step 4: Installation
If deciding for glass replacement, the professional will eliminate the old glass and set up the new one, guaranteeing appropriate sealing and insulation. For full window replacement, the entire frame might likewise be replaced to prevent future issues.
Step 5: Follow-Up
Post-replacement, monitor the windows for any indications of condensation or issues. Routine upkeep and cleansing can extend the life expectancy of your new windows.

Frequently Asked Question about Misted Window Replacement
Q1: Can I clean up the misted windows myself?
A1: While you can clean up the outside of the glass, misting in between panes normally requires professional assistance, as it includes seal integrity.
Q2: How much does it cost to replace misted windows?
A2: Costs can vary extensively, normally ranging from ₤ 200 to ₤ 600 per window for glass replacement, while complete window replacements can go up to ₤ 1000 or more, depending upon the design and material.
Q3: How long does the replacement procedure take?
A3: The installation of new glass can typically take a couple of hours, while full window replacements might take a day or 2, depending upon the number of windows.
Q4: Is there a method to prevent misting in the future?
A4: Proper setup and regular upkeep are crucial. Investing in premium windows with solid warranties will likewise assist mitigate future concerns.
Q5: What kinds of windows are best for preventing misting?
A5: Double-glazed windows with argon gas fills and premium seals are frequently more reliable at avoiding misting due to their better insulation residential or commercial properties.
